Bob Sima (3 Dec 2011)

Dec 3, 7:00 - 10 pm: Bob Sima (Black Tie with Bob)

Bob's return visit to Monkey House was a lovely, intimate experience.  An award-winning singer/songwriter,  Bob playedtwo 45-minute sets, with a 20-minute intermission.   You didn't really have to wear a "black tie," but this event was special anyway!

"For anyone who wishes Van Morrison were still making rustic acoustic soul records like Tupelo Honey, Bob Sima's Pour It On will bring you joy.

"Bob's songs sound like they could have been bursting out of back porch radios for the past 40 years. But they don't make you nostalgic so much as they make you look forward to what Sima will do next."  Drew Pearce -  Acoustic Guitar Magazine
